Congestion Control Oriented Joint Power Control and Channel Assignment for WMN

Abstract: In order to solve the resource distribution problem in the joint resource allocation model,a novel power control and channel assignment algorithm is proposed,which is named CCJPCA ( Congestion Control oriented Joint Power control and Channel assignment Algorithm) . In the CCJPCA algorithm,the hybrid coding
strategy is used to achieve the co-evolution of the power and channel variable. The reward mechanism of Q-Learning algorithm is used to realize the adaptive selection of mutation strategy,which ensures the reasonable allocation of network resource. The simulation results based on NS-3 ( Network Simulator-3 ) indicate that CCJPCA algorithm can give priority to network resources of network bottleneck links, achieve algorithm convergence speed,reduce network queuing and retransmission delay,and lower the average packet loss ratio.

Key words: wireless Mesh network, power control, congestion control, channel assignment
